Acute confusional migraine
(
ACM
) is recognized as a rare, but highly disabling migraine equivalent, mostly reported in children and adolescents. Herein we describe the case of a 12-year-old girl admitted to hospital for an acute confusional state and severe psychomotor agitation, associated with a pulsating headache and
nausea
, which turned out to be a manifestation of
ACM
. The girl was discharged on topiramate prophylaxis, titrated up to 75 mg/die; no recurrence of confusional and/or headache episodes has been reported over the last 14 months to date. Due to the rarity of this clinical entity, only anecdotal reports about acute and prophylactic treatment of
ACM
are available in the literature. The case reported herein suggests that topiramate seems to be effective in
ACM
prophylaxis, although a longer observation period in our patient and more cases are needed to confirm any long-term clinical benefit.
